OpenAI's upheaval sees CEO Sam Altman ousted and now sought back by the board. Altman's potential return triggers staff resignations, hinting at deeper rifts. Senior researchers depart, signaling discontent after Altman's removal, while uncertainties loom over the company's leadership amidst AI safety concerns.

In a sudden twist, OpenAI faced turmoil as its board ousted CEO Sam Altman, only to consider his return within a 24-hour span. Altman's dismissal, conducted through a video call, prompted mixed feelings from him, and reports suggest he's contemplating a comeback with proposed governance changes.

A significant development unfolded as a reported agreement for Altman and co-founder Greg Brockman's return faltered, missing a pivotal deadline that could have averted numerous resignations among OpenAI's workforce.

Speculation loomed over Altman's departure and the possibility of his endeavoring a new venture, potentially drawing some of his erstwhile colleagues. The aftermath of Altman's ousting saw the departure of senior researchers, including Szymon Sidor, Aleksander Madry, and Jakub Pachocki, emblematic of the discontentment within OpenAI's ranks post-Altman's removal. Their exits signified a broader dissatisfaction, reflecting internal rifts, especially concerning AI safety practices.

The departures, compounded by the resignation of Brockman and Altman, underscored substantial discord within OpenAI. The situation hinted at a turbulent internal climate, significantly impacting the organization's future trajectory.

Remarkably, silence enveloped the board's stance on Altman's potential return, leaving the company's direction in limbo. OpenAI, steered by prominent figures like Adam D'Angelo and Ilya Sutskever, faced mounting unrest and speculation surrounding Sutskever's involvement in Altman's removal, further complicating the company's internal dynamics.

The prevailing uncertainty raised pressing questions about OpenAI's stability and strategic path, fueling speculation about the company's future and its ability to navigate the escalating internal turmoil.
